#7f45b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f45b0 is composed of 49.8% red, 27.1%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 272.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.7% and a lightness of 48%. #7f45b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e8aff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#7f45b0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7f45b0 has RGB values of R:127, G:69,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 8340912.

Hex triplet 7f45b0 #7f45b0
RGB Decimal 127, 69, 176 rgb(127,69,176)
RGB Percent 49.8, 27.1, 69 rgb(49.8%,27.1%,69%)
CMYK 28, 61, 0, 31
HSL 272.5°, 43.7, 48 hsl(272.5,43.7%,48%)
HSV (or HSB) 272.5°, 60.8, 69
Web Safe 663399 #663399
CIE-LAB 41.062, 44.933, -47.648
XYZ 18.716, 11.903, 42.383
xyY 0.256, 0.163, 11.903
CIE-LCH 41.062, 65.492, 313.32
CIE-LUV 41.062, 17.575, -73.726
Hunter-Lab 34.501, 36.455, -48.685
Binary 01111111, 01000101, 10110000

Shades and Tints of #7f45b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050307 is the darkest color, while #faf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f45b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7481 is the less saturated color, while #8503f2 is the most saturated one.
